What it does: Imagine all that dirt and grime your face absorbs just by going outside. This activated charcoal and kaolin clay-based mask helps draw out those impurities from the pores while leaving a visibly brighter complexion. Also, so we’re all on the same page here… “activated” means it has at one point been heated to up its absorption benefits.
How to apply: Apply a generous amount to clean, damp skin. You can rub in circular motions using your fingertips, or what I like to do is evenly apply the product with a foundation brush. Leave on for 10-15 minutes and then gently rinse with warm water and pat dry. Personally, I like to multi-mask when I’m not relying on a sheet mask. I use this activated charcoal mask on my t-zone (forehead and nose area) and then apply a moisturizing formula on my cheeks and chin (I love this one by Glossier).
What it felt like: It feels like a typical pore cleansing mask. It dries out pretty quickly but it doesn?t feel uncomfortable or sticky.
